Output d121164b53b01af2db985079150bc72ef9436876a509e4e2491908cbfcc29bee:1

value
35256806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d44b43f4b52e68e3e50dd7fb584013426f01e3 OP_EQUAL
address
32azKiW188cBgyzj2aGheUwqoy6aNCxdzK
transaction
d121164b53b01af2db985079150bc72ef9436876a509e4e2491908cbfcc29bee
spent
true